Magnesium Glycinate Dosing
For general supplementation in healthy adults, magnesium glycinate should be dosed at 250 mg of elemental magnesium daily, which represents a safe and effective starting point based on recent clinical trial evidence.
Standard Dosing Recommendations
General Adult Dosing
- Start with 250 mg elemental magnesium daily for adults with self-reported sleep problems or general supplementation needs 1
- The Recommended Dietary Allowance (RDA) is 320 mg/day for women and 420 mg/day for men 2
- For therapeutic purposes beyond basic supplementation, doses up to 350 mg/day from supplements are considered safe (the Tolerable Upper Intake Level) 2
Form-Specific Considerations
- Magnesium glycinate (bisglycinate) is an amino acid-bound organic compound that demonstrates superior bioavailability compared to inorganic forms like magnesium oxide 3
- A recent 2025 trial used 250 mg elemental magnesium as magnesium bisglycinate daily and showed modest but significant improvements in insomnia severity over 4 weeks 1
- Liquid or dissolvable magnesium products are generally better tolerated than pills 2
Clinical Context and Adjustments
When to Use Higher Doses
- For chronic idiopathic constipation: Start with 400-500 mg daily of magnesium oxide (not glycinate) and titrate based on response 2
- For erythromelalgia: Begin at the RDA (320-420 mg daily) and increase gradually according to tolerance, with some patients requiring 600-6500 mg daily 2
- For short bowel syndrome: Much higher doses of 12-24 mmol daily (480-960 mg elemental magnesium) may be necessary, preferably given at night 2
Timing and Administration
- Administer at night when intestinal transit is slowest to optimize absorption, particularly in patients with malabsorption 2
- For high doses, splitting into divided doses throughout the day may improve tolerance, though this approach did not significantly increase tissue magnesium levels in animal studies 3
Critical Safety Considerations
Absolute Contraindications
- Avoid magnesium supplementation in patients with creatinine clearance <20 mL/min due to severe hypermagnesemia risk 2
- Do not use in patients with renal insufficiency without close monitoring 2
Monitoring Requirements
- Check renal function before initiating supplementation 2
- Monitor for signs of magnesium toxicity including hypotension, bradycardia, and respiratory depression 2
- Common side effects include diarrhea and gastrointestinal intolerance, which are dose-dependent 2

Important Clinical Pearls
Bioavailability Considerations
- Organic magnesium salts (glycinate, citrate, malate) have superior bioavailability compared to inorganic forms (oxide, hydroxide) 2
- Magnesium glycinate specifically increased brain magnesium levels in preclinical studies, suggesting good CNS penetration 3
Common Pitfalls to Avoid
- Do not attempt to correct magnesium deficiency without first addressing volume depletion in patients with diarrhea or high-output stomas, as secondary hyperaldosteronism will cause continued renal magnesium wasting 2
- Recognize that serum magnesium levels do not accurately reflect total body magnesium status, as less than 1% of body magnesium is in the blood 2
- Always correct hypomagnesemia before attempting to treat refractory hypokalemia, as magnesium deficiency causes dysfunction of potassium transport systems 2
